Product Description:

The 8LSA65.EB045D200-3 is a three-phase synchronous motor manufactured by B & R Automation for the 8LS Synchronous Motors series. As a servo actuator, it converts drive currents into precise torque for positioning axes, feed drives, and handling modules in industrial automation lines that require fast speed changes and a compact footprint. A 190 mm mounting flange connects directly to compatible gearboxes or machine frames without requiring additional mounting brackets.

This model reaches a rated speed of 4500 rpm, providing a wide operating range before field weakening is required. Feedback is delivered by an inductive EnDat sensor that supports EnDat version 2.1. It provides 19/12 bits of single-turn and multi-turn resolution, respectively, allowing accurate electronic commutation and absolute position recovery after power loss. Cabling exits through an angled swivel connector, allowing the motor leads to be directed toward the control cabinet without increasing installation depth. The length code 5 lamination stack provides the active iron volume needed for medium-inertia applications. Power is routed through a sealed connector housing that helps protect the electrical connections from contaminants encountered during normal industrial operation.

Thermal control relies on self-cooling with free air circulation, avoiding external fans while dissipating losses generated during continuous operation. Motion is held during power-off by a standard holding brake, which helps prevent unintended movement when drive power is unavailable. An internal sensor confirms the brake status for controller interlock functions. The absence of an oil seal reduces shaft friction and supports longer maintenance intervals when the motor operates in a clean environment. The configuration uses a standard bearing set without reinforcement, providing support for loads that remain within the motor’s normal operating range. A smooth shaft minimizes runout when used with a precision clamping coupling. Product revision 3 uses a connector pinout compatible with the corresponding B & R drive controllers.

Configuration Summary
8LSA: Standard, no reinforced bearing
Connection direction
Angled (swivel)
Connection Hardware
Connector
Cooling Principle
Self-cooling, free circulation
Designation
8LSA
Encoder Technology
Inductive EnDat
EnDat Version
2.1
Flange Dimension
190 (mm)
Holding Brake
Standard holding brake
Length Code
5
Motor Type
Three-phase synchronous
Mounting Availability
Mounting flange
Oil Seal
Not Present
Product Revision
3
Rated Speed
4500 (rpm)
Resolution
19/12 (Single/Multi-turn bits)
Shaft End
Smooth shaft
Turn Capability
Multi-turn (4096 revs)
